xref: /linux/Documentation/devicetree/bindings/nvmem/ingenic,jz4780-efuse.yaml (revision af934656d848426aae7248cbebe786d430704011)
1*af934656SPrasannaKumar Muralidharan# SPDX-License-Identifier: GPL-2.0-only OR BSD-2-Clause
2*af934656SPrasannaKumar Muralidharan%YAML 1.2
3*af934656SPrasannaKumar Muralidharan---
4*af934656SPrasannaKumar Muralidharan$id: http://devicetree.org/schemas/nvmem/ingenic,jz4780-efuse.yaml#
5*af934656SPrasannaKumar Muralidharan$schema: http://devicetree.org/meta-schemas/core.yaml#
6*af934656SPrasannaKumar Muralidharan
7*af934656SPrasannaKumar Muralidharantitle: Ingenic JZ EFUSE driver bindings
8*af934656SPrasannaKumar Muralidharan
9*af934656SPrasannaKumar Muralidharanmaintainers:
10*af934656SPrasannaKumar Muralidharan  - PrasannaKumar Muralidharan <prasannatsmkumar@gmail.com>
11*af934656SPrasannaKumar Muralidharan
12*af934656SPrasannaKumar MuralidharanallOf:
13*af934656SPrasannaKumar Muralidharan  - $ref: "nvmem.yaml#"
14*af934656SPrasannaKumar Muralidharan
15*af934656SPrasannaKumar Muralidharanproperties:
16*af934656SPrasannaKumar Muralidharan  compatible:
17*af934656SPrasannaKumar Muralidharan    enum:
18*af934656SPrasannaKumar Muralidharan      - ingenic,jz4780-efuse
19*af934656SPrasannaKumar Muralidharan
20*af934656SPrasannaKumar Muralidharan  reg:
21*af934656SPrasannaKumar Muralidharan    maxItems: 1
22*af934656SPrasannaKumar Muralidharan
23*af934656SPrasannaKumar Muralidharan  clocks:
24*af934656SPrasannaKumar Muralidharan    # Handle for the ahb for the efuse.
25*af934656SPrasannaKumar Muralidharan    maxItems: 1
26*af934656SPrasannaKumar Muralidharan
27*af934656SPrasannaKumar Muralidharanrequired:
28*af934656SPrasannaKumar Muralidharan  - compatible
29*af934656SPrasannaKumar Muralidharan  - reg
30*af934656SPrasannaKumar Muralidharan  - clocks
31*af934656SPrasannaKumar Muralidharan
32*af934656SPrasannaKumar MuralidharanunevaluatedProperties: false
33*af934656SPrasannaKumar Muralidharan
34*af934656SPrasannaKumar Muralidharanexamples:
35*af934656SPrasannaKumar Muralidharan  - |
36*af934656SPrasannaKumar Muralidharan    #include <dt-bindings/clock/jz4780-cgu.h>
37*af934656SPrasannaKumar Muralidharan
38*af934656SPrasannaKumar Muralidharan    efuse@134100d0 {
39*af934656SPrasannaKumar Muralidharan        compatible = "ingenic,jz4780-efuse";
40*af934656SPrasannaKumar Muralidharan        reg = <0x134100d0 0x2c>;
41*af934656SPrasannaKumar Muralidharan
42*af934656SPrasannaKumar Muralidharan        clocks = <&cgu JZ4780_CLK_AHB2>;
43*af934656SPrasannaKumar Muralidharan    };
44*af934656SPrasannaKumar Muralidharan
45*af934656SPrasannaKumar Muralidharan...
46